Has anyone tried any of those Online/PC Pokemon games?

The ones that haven't been shut down by Nintendo? I REALLY love Pokemon 3D, it's really easing my anxiety for X.
I used to play Pokemon World Online, which, even in its buggy beta form was awesome fun. It's still around as far as I know but they have timed sign-up times due to small server sizes. The guy who runs it does so out of a college dorm or something.
Yes, they're all terrible.
What is Pokémon Generations like?